Description
Technologies, protocols, & techniques used to connect a computer network with other gateways that provide a common method of routing information packets among the networks. Internet technologies for the connection of computing devices with other internal & external devices or systems. Topics include Local Area Networks (LAN) & Wide Area Networks (WAN) implementation, wireless network implementation, network security, advanced switching & routing configuration, advanced TCP/IP configuration, & network management.
